Description

  • Coordinate project schedules to meet budget and deadline requirements for subcontractors and installation teams.
  • Work closely with sales, design personnel, estimators, and designers on project specifications, manpower needs, and change orders.
  • Review construction contract documents and coordinate with subcontractors and general contractors to gather project information.
  • Track key project milestones and communicate deadlines such as design start, listing, and POJ dates to the VSC team.
  • Prepare, issue, and follow up on ASIs, RFIs, change orders, subcontracts, and purchase orders.
  • Monitor project budgets and documentation to help increase profitability.
  • Ensure compliance with company, local, state, and federal fire, NFPA, building, and safety regulations.
  • Enforce safety policies and maintain proper risk management procedures on all job sites.
  • Gather information needed for sprinkler system drawings, hydraulic calculations, seismic brace calculations, and material/equipment schedules.
  • Submit stock lists to fabrication, approve fabrication quotes, and order additional material needed for installation.

Requirements

  • 3 to 5 years of project management experience in sprinkler or integrated systems.
  • Knowledge of company, local, state, and federal regulations, including fire, NFPA, building, and safety requirements.
  • Ability to schedule projects in logical steps to meet budget and time deadlines.
  • Strong attention to detail, communication skills, and ability to meet deadlines.
  • Ability to pass various background checks.
  • Reliable transportation and a valid state driver's license with an acceptable driving record for use of a company vehicle.
  • Desirable, but not required: experience using AutoCAD or SprinkCAD.
  • Experience coordinating with subcontractors and general contractors.
  • Familiarity with project communication and documentation processes such as ASIs, RFIs, change orders, subcontracts, and purchase orders.
